Australia’s most exciting queer comedy duo: Mel & Sam host their brand new podcast: RATBAG. Join them as these besties and also quasi-reformed-theatre-kids host weekly episodes every Monday and Thursday. With everything from unpacking conspiracies, to riffing on their always-open-always-caring-about-you hotline, it’s vital this podcast is in your weekly listening rotation. In this pod, Mel & Sam bring the late-night-kick-ons chats to you but rather than it being 3am and you’re wedged between two randoms with an eyelash cascading down your face, you’re listening whenever you want... so go for that "walk", buy that overpriced matcha latte and get it in your ear holes you RATBAGS.
